About Bandwidth Inc

Bandwidth is a global communications software company. Its CPaaS platform allows enterprises to embed voice, messaging, and 911 emergency services directly into their software applications via robust APIs.

About Canopy Growth Corp

Canopy Growth, headquartered in Smiths Falls, Canada, cultivates and sells medicinal and recreational cannabis, and hemp, through a portfolio of brands that include Tweed, Spectrum Therapeutics, and CraftGrow. Although it primarily operates in Canada, Canopy has distribution and production licenses in more than a dozen countries to drive expansion in global medical cannabis and also holds an option to acquire Acreage Holdings upon U.S. federal cannabis legalization.
